C# Class StoryTeller.Model.Persistence.Suite

Mostrar archivo Open project: storyteller/Storyteller Class Usage Examples

Public Properties

Property Type Description
name string
path string

Public Methods

Method Description
AddChildSuite ( Suite newSuite ) : void
AddSpec ( Specification spec ) : void
GetAllSpecs ( ) : IEnumerable
JoinPath ( string parent, string name ) : string
RemoveSpec ( Specification old ) : void
ReplaceSpecification ( Specification spec ) : void
SuitePathOf ( string path ) : string
ToHierarchy ( ) : Hierarchy
WritePath ( string parentFolder ) : void

Private Methods

Method Description
organizeIntoHierarchy ( Hierarchy hierarchy ) : void

Method Details

AddChildSuite() public method

public AddChildSuite ( Suite newSuite ) : void
newSuite Suite
return void

AddSpec() public method

public AddSpec ( Specification spec ) : void
spec Specification
return void

GetAllSpecs() public method

public GetAllSpecs ( ) : IEnumerable
return IEnumerable

JoinPath() public static method

public static JoinPath ( string parent, string name ) : string
parent string
name string
return string

RemoveSpec() public method

public RemoveSpec ( Specification old ) : void
old Specification
return void

ReplaceSpecification() public method

public ReplaceSpecification ( Specification spec ) : void
spec Specification
return void

SuitePathOf() public static method

public static SuitePathOf ( string path ) : string
path string
return string

ToHierarchy() public method

public ToHierarchy ( ) : Hierarchy
return Hierarchy

WritePath() public method

public WritePath ( string parentFolder ) : void
parentFolder string
return void

Property Details

name public_oe property

public string name
return string

path public_oe property

public string path
return string